The National Institute on Drug Abuse (NIDA) provides a comprehensive definition of drug addiction, stating, “addiction is defined as a chronic, relapsing brain disease that is characterized by compulsive drug seeking and use, despite harmful consequences.†Addiction is recognized as a brain disease because drugs literally cause changes to the brain. It is important to understand that detox is NOT rehabilitation, and can only assist an addict to withdraw from drugs and alcohol, not end their addiction. According to the National Council on Alcoholism and Drug Dependence, the following are signs that an individual may have a drug abuse problem and should seek help: Using drugs in higher doses, using more often, or using for longer than intended; not being able to control use No longer participating in activities that used to be enjoyable Struggling with relationships due to drug use Being unable to keep up with responsibilities at work, school, or home Hiding substance use from others Running out of prescription drugs faster than expected or stealing drugs from others In addition, if the person feels unable to function without using the substance, or experiences withdrawal symptoms when drug use is stopped, drug abuse or addiction may be present.
